Unlike the god old days where plumbing technicians had to dig enormous openings to find the trouble, they now take advantage of innovation.
Today's qualified plumbers dig small openings on the ground for a cam evaluation to locate the drain line problems. After, they insert a thin epoxy-reliner, which is cured in position, leaving a brand-new pipe within the old pipe. Less Harmful
Trenchless pipeline lining fixing techniques just need a small access point to carry out both video camera inspections and also the repair service itself. This remains in contrast to traditional methods, which necessitate the excavating of a significant trench in your backyard or a hole in your wall surface to reach the pipe. This not just reduces home damages yet also conserves your pocketbook from being thinned out from added landscape design or fixing costs!
Reduces Considerable Damages to Property
Conventional sewer repair service plumbing methods needed enormous digs that ruined garages, gardens, basement flooring, and maybe even walls. That's a lot of collateral damage, which you need to repair later. However, the trenchless method only digs a small opening, leaving your building intact.

Why You Should Use Trenchless Technology for Orangeburg Pipes
Types of Trenchless Technology
The common types of trenchless technology you would employ to reinforce your pipes would include:
Pipe Lining
Cured-in-place pipe lining (CIPP) is the most effective trenchless technology solution for Orangeburg pipes; however, it will still depend on the pipes durability and condition.
This repair process is conducted through an existing opening in your sewer. Once the plumbing technician has access to that opening, he or she will insert an epoxy-coated liner into the pipe and the inside will be coated with resin. After the application of these materials, the pipe will harden to reinforce the pipe’s structure making it more resilient than before.
Pipe Bursting
If the damage to your Orangeburg pipes is widespread throughout the system, pipe bursting may be your solution. Pipe bursting is a trenchless alternative to manual pipe replacement, in situations where lining the existing pipe would not restore damages fully. It’s often used for heavily deteriorated Orangeburg pipes.
Trenchless specialists replace your collapsed pipes completely without the need to dig out the damaged pipe by using steel, conical bursting heads, which are attached to new pipes. The cone bursting head fractures and displaces the old pipe, while simultaneously laying in place a new pipe, all through small entry and exit points. This trenchless method not only preserves your former pipes, but also is the most efficiently means to repair a severely damaged Orangeburg pipe system
